Составная сборка Gradle со свойствами ext или глобальными переменными - PullRequest
0 голосов
/ 27 марта 2020

У меня есть составной проект с чем-то похожим на следующую структуру:

 - Main
   -- A
     --- 1
       ---- m
       ---- n
     --- 2
       ---- p
   -- B
     --- 3
       ---- q
       ---- r

1, 2 и 3 являются сборками нескольких проектов. A и B - это просто каталоги, используемые для организации.

Я бы хотел сделать что-то в Main build.gradle, включающее что-то вроде ниже, и передать их в проекты, обозначенные строчными буквами.

ext {
   prop1 = "foo"
   prop2 = "bar"
}

Есть идеи как это сделать или альтернативы?

...